I don't know how the fuel system on his truck was set up, but the Detroit powered Cascadias have a heater in the fuel filter. Starting procedures are to turn the key on and leave it on for at least five minutes to warm the fuel filter. Hopefully, it should start. A block heater would also help, but it looks like he has no provision to plug it in where he is parked. Cascadias also have a habit of leaking coolant in the area of the DEF tank, at least that was the case with mine when it was cold out.

The problem with DEF is that its 2/3rds or 67.5% is deionized (minerals, some of them prevents frost) WATER, the rest (32.5%) is Urea and yeah it will freeze if the heater system (if equipped) is not plugged in or the engine is not running idle or APU not running to keep things warm. Also fuel additive such as antigel can only offer so much protection, freeze protection is not one it can do. Thus why its good idea to invest in a heating blanket to plug in for the night or day when its 12°F (-11°C) or lower or get an APU at least for winter to keep the fluids and truck cabin warm and such. Or some aftermarket drop in electric heater as recommended.

Diesel Exhaust Fluid (DEF) is an aqueous urea solution made with 32.5% urea and 67.5% deionized water. DEF is used as a consumable in selective catalytic reduction (SCR) in order to lower NOx concentration in the diesel exhaust emissions from diesel engines. WIKI
